Best 63111 Missouri Private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 3 private schools serving 471 students in 63111, MO (there are 2 public schools, serving 519 public students). 48% of all K-12 students in 63111, MO are educated in private schools (compared to the MO state average of 12%).
The top ranked private school in 63111, MO is St. Mary's High School.
67% of private schools in 63111, MO are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ic).
